| dc.description.abstract | Background: Pancreatic ductal adenocarcinoma (PDAC) has a high propensity for locoregional recurrence despite curative surgery. We designed a phase II study to evaluate locoregional recurrence and mortality in patients with resectable pancreatic cancer (RPC) treated with intraoperative radiotherapy (IORT) using a 50-kV low-energy X-ray source. This report presents the final results. Methods: In a prospective single-institution phase II trial, the efficacy of IORT using a 50-kV low-energy X-ray source in resectable PDAC was evaluated. Thirty-eight patients underwent curative pancreatectomy followed by IORT delivering 10 Gy at 5-mm depth (approximate to 16 Gy on the surface). Gemcitabine-based chemotherapy was administered postoperatively in most cases. The primary endpoint was the 2-year local recurrence rate, and the secondary endpoints were recurrence-free survival (RFS) and overall survival (OS). Cox regression was used to identify the prognostic factors. Results: The 1-and 2-year local recurrence rates were 33.2% and 57.7%, respectively. The median local RFS was 19 months, and the median OS was 43 months. Multivariate analysis identified perineural invasion (PNI) and margin status (R1 vs. R0) as significant predictors of local recurrence, whereas lymphovascular invasion (LVI) and tumor-vessel contact >= 90 degrees were associated with poor OS. Conclusions: Low-energy X-ray IORT was feasible and well tolerated, showing a potential benefit in local control, particularly for patients with microscopic residual disease (R1 resection). PNI, LVI, and tumor-vessel interactions emerged as important prognostic factors. Larger multicenter randomized trials are warranted to confirm these findings. | - |
